自学习AI Agent选型指南:从功能特性到适用场景的深度解析
2026.05.10 02:29浏览量:0简介:本文通过对比分析两种主流自学习AI Agent的技术特性,详细解读其核心功能、部署方式及适用场景。针对开发者与企业用户,提供从安装配置到高级功能调用的完整实践指南,帮助读者快速掌握智能体选型的关键决策要素。
一、技术演进背景与核心差异
在人工智能技术快速迭代的背景下,自学习智能体(Self-Learning AI Agent)已成为自动化任务处理的重要载体。这类系统通过内置的强化学习循环机制,能够从交互经验中持续优化行为策略,形成独特的”经验-反馈-改进”闭环。当前市场上主流的两种技术方案均具备以下核心特性:
- 持续学习能力:通过记忆模块存储历史对话数据,支持基于上下文的策略优化
- 多模态工具集成:可扩展调用Web搜索、终端命令、代码执行等外部能力
- 个性化配置系统:允许用户自定义行为模式、知识库范围及响应风格
两种技术方案在架构设计上存在显著差异:方案A采用模块化微服务架构,将记忆存储、策略引擎与工具调用解耦为独立服务;方案B则选择单体式设计,通过进程内通信实现低延迟交互。这种设计差异直接影响了系统的扩展性与资源消耗特性。
二、核心功能对比分析
1. 记忆管理机制
方案A的记忆系统支持三级存储策略:
- 短期记忆:基于滑动窗口的对话上下文缓存(默认保留最近20轮交互)
- 长期记忆:通过向量数据库存储关键知识节点(支持Elasticsearch/Milvus等主流引擎)
- 永久记忆:结构化知识图谱的持久化存储(支持Neo4j等图数据库)
方案B则采用更简单的键值存储模型,通过标记系统识别需要记忆的内容。例如当检测到”记住我的偏好设置”这类指令时,会自动将后续参数存入持久化存储。
2. 工具链集成能力
两种方案均支持通过插件机制扩展功能,但在实现方式上存在差异:
# 方案A的插件开发示例(Python)class WebSearchPlugin:def __init__(self, api_key):self.engine = SearchEngine(api_key)def execute(self, query):results = self.engine.search(query, limit=5)return [r.summary for r in results]# 方案B的工具配置示例(YAML)tools:- name: terminaltype: systemcommand: /bin/bash- name: calculatortype: pythonmodule: math_ops
方案A提供更完整的开发框架,包含请求路由、结果解析和异常处理等基础组件;方案B则强调轻量化配置,适合快速集成现有工具。
3. 学习效率优化
在持续学习方面,方案A引入了经验回放机制(Experience Replay),通过优先采样重要交互样本加速策略收敛。其学习循环可表示为:
新经验 → 存入回放缓冲区 → 随机采样训练 → 策略网络更新 → 行为优化
方案B采用更简单的在线学习模式,每轮交互后立即进行梯度更新。这种设计在数据量较小时收敛更快,但可能面临灾难性遗忘(Catastrophic Forgetting)问题。
三、部署与运维实践
1. 标准化安装流程
两种方案均提供一键安装脚本,但方案A的部署过程更复杂:
# 方案A完整安装流程curl -fsSL https://example.com/install.sh | bash # 基础环境source ~/.bashrchermes setup --full # 全量配置向导hermes doctor --check # 系统健康检查# 方案B简化安装wget https://example.com/quickstart.tar.gztar -xzf quickstart.tar.gzcd agent-dir && ./start.sh
2. 资源消耗对比
在相同硬件环境下(4核8G虚拟机)的基准测试显示:
| 指标 | 方案A | 方案B |
|———————|———-|———-|
| 空闲内存占用 | 420MB | 280MB |
| 响应延迟(ms) | 320 | 180 |
| 吞吐量(QPS) | 45 | 72 |
方案B在资源利用率方面表现更优,但方案A通过水平扩展可支持更高的并发需求。
3. 运维监控体系
方案A提供完整的监控解决方案:
- Prometheus指标接口:暴露300+运营指标
- Grafana仪表盘模板:开箱即用的可视化方案
- 日志分析系统:支持ELK栈集成
方案B仅提供基础日志输出,需要用户自行搭建监控体系。
四、典型应用场景分析
1. 个人知识管理
对于需要处理大量文档的研究人员,方案A的记忆系统更具优势。其向量检索功能可实现:
- 语义搜索:通过自然语言查询相关文档段落
- 关联推荐:自动发现知识间的隐含联系
- 摘要生成:快速提取长文档的核心观点
2. 企业级自动化
在客服场景中,方案B的轻量化特性使其成为更优选择:
- 快速集成:30分钟内完成与现有工单系统的对接
- 低资源消耗:单实例可支持200+并发会话
- 灵活定制:通过规则引擎配置业务特定逻辑
3. 开发辅助场景
两种方案均能胜任代码生成任务,但方案A的上下文理解能力更强:
- 支持跨文件引用分析
- 可识别代码中的潜在缺陷
- 提供多版本修改建议
五、选型决策框架
建议从以下维度进行综合评估:
- 技术复杂度:方案A适合有专业运维团队的企业,方案B更适合个人开发者
- 功能需求:需要高级记忆管理选方案A,追求快速集成选方案B
- 扩展预期:方案A的模块化设计支持更复杂的定制开发
- 成本考量:方案B的硬件要求更低,长期运营成本更具优势
对于大多数普通用户,建议从方案B开始入门,待熟悉智能体工作原理后再评估是否需要升级到方案A。两种方案均提供完善的文档支持,开发者可通过官方教程快速掌握核心功能的使用方法。
在人工智能技术持续发展的今天,自学习智能体正在重塑人机协作的边界。通过合理选择技术方案,开发者可以构建出既符合业务需求又具备成长潜力的智能系统,为数字化转型提供强有力的技术支撑。

发表评论
登录后可评论,请前往 登录 或 注册